The Round of 32 games in the Nedbank Cup continue as the week progresses in the next few days, and there could be a long-awaited return for one star player…
Maritzburg United's Siyanda Xulu hasn't featured for the Team of Choice since picking up a serious injury back in November, but having made the bench for their last two games, this weekend's tie with Stellenbosch could see him back in action.
Eric Tinkler's side has been in impressive form in 2019/20 considering they were almost relegated last season, and now he wants to have a real go at the Nedbank Cup after narrowly missing out on the Telkom Knockout last year.
They do, however, have a couple of suspensions to deal with that could see Xulu make his first appearance since November, while Judas Moseamedi is a doubt due to an injury niggle.
Speaking to the club's official website, the club's head coach said, "Pogiso Sanoka and Gabriel Nyoni both miss out on the game due to suspension. Judas Moseamedi is being assessed. Everyone else is available."
Maritzburg face Stellenbosch at 20h00 on Friday night.
